Class SwrveNotification
- java.lang.Object
-
- com.swrve.sdk.notifications.model.SwrveNotification
-
public class SwrveNotification extends java.lang.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
SwrveNotification.VisibilityType
-
Constructor Summary
Constructors Constructor Description SwrveNotification()
-
Method Summary
-
-
-
Method Detail
-
fromJson
public static SwrveNotification fromJson(java.lang.String json)
-
getVersion
public int getVersion()
-
getTitle
public java.lang.String getTitle()
-
setTitle
public void setTitle(java.lang.String title)
-
getSubtitle
public java.lang.String getSubtitle()
-
setSubtitle
public void setSubtitle(java.lang.String subtitle)
-
getIconUrl
public java.lang.String getIconUrl()
-
setIconUrl
public void setIconUrl(java.lang.String iconUrl)
-
getAccent
public java.lang.String getAccent()
-
setAccent
public void setAccent(java.lang.String accent)
-
getPriority
public int getPriority()
-
setPriority
public void setPriority(int priority)
-
getTicker
public java.lang.String getTicker()
-
setTicker
public void setTicker(java.lang.String ticker)
-
getNotificationId
public int getNotificationId()
-
setNotificationId
public void setNotificationId(int notificationId)
-
getVisibility
public SwrveNotification.VisibilityType getVisibility()
-
setVisibility
public void setVisibility(SwrveNotification.VisibilityType visibility)
-
getLockScreenMsg
public java.lang.String getLockScreenMsg()
-
setLockScreenMsg
public void setLockScreenMsg(java.lang.String lockScreenMsg)
-
getMedia
public SwrveNotificationMedia getMedia()
-
setMedia
public void setMedia(SwrveNotificationMedia media)
-
getExpanded
public SwrveNotificationExpanded getExpanded()
-
setExpanded
public void setExpanded(SwrveNotificationExpanded expanded)
-
getButtons
public java.util.List<SwrveNotificationButton> getButtons()
-
setButtons
public void setButtons(java.util.List<SwrveNotificationButton> buttons)
-
getChannelId
public java.lang.String getChannelId()
-
setChannelId
public void setChannelId(java.lang.String channelId)
-
getChannel
public SwrveNotificationChannel getChannel()
-
setChannel
public void setChannel(SwrveNotificationChannel channel)
-
setVersion
public void setVersion(int version)
-
getCampaign
public SwrveNotificationCampaign getCampaign()
-
setCampaign
public void setCampaign(SwrveNotificationCampaign campaign)
-
-